
A Sobering Health Update for a Nation
On May 18, 2025, the U.S. experienced a sobering moment as former President Joseph R. Biden Jr. announced his diagnosis of an aggressive form of prostate cancer that has metastasized to his bones. This revelation comes shortly after he left office as the oldest-serving president in American history, stirring significant concerns regarding health and longevity among Americans of all ages.
Understanding Prostate Cancer: Gleason Scores and Staging
Biden's diagnosis highlights the critical nature of understanding prostate cancer, specifically how it is assessed through Gleason scores — a system that categorizes cancer based on microscopic evaluation. A Gleason score of 9 indicates an aggressive form of cancer, falling under Stage 4, meaning it has spread beyond the prostate. This information isn’t just relevant for Biden; it underscores the importance of prostate health checks for men over 50, a demographic that frequently faces this type of cancer.
Response From Medical Experts: A Glimmer of Hope
Despite the grim prognosis of Stage 4 prostate cancer, experts like Dr. Judd Moul from Duke University express cautious optimism. They note that while the cancer cannot be cured at this stage, with effective management, patients can potentially live five to ten years or more. This brings hope to those facing similar battles, as the evolving treatments offer advancements that can extend quality life.
